In 2023, the integration of AI tools in marketing strategies has become prevalent. These tools analyze vast amounts of data to understand consumer preferences and trends. This ability allows brands to tailor their offerings and marketing strategies for maximum impact.
As AI technology evolves, consumer trust in its recommendations is growing. A study indicated that 67% of consumers feel comfortable relying on AI-generated suggestions for purchasing decisions. This is particularly evident in regions like Indonesia, where digital literacy is increasing rapidly, making consumers more receptive to AI insights.
The Southeast Asian market, particularly countries like Indonesia, Malaysia, and the Philippines, is experiencing a digital revolution. As more individuals gain access to the internet, brands are leveraging AI tools to enhance their marketing strategies. In major cities like Jakarta and Surabaya, businesses are adopting AI to better understand local consumer behavior.
Data plays a critical role in shaping AI recommendations. The algorithms behind these tools rely on user data to provide personalized recommendations. This process not only helps brands reach potential customers but also ensures that the suggestions resonate with consumers' needs and preferences.
